Agriculture is a major contributor to greenhouse gas emissions globally and is highly vulnerable to climate impacts. Energy access affects the ability of smallholder farmers in SADC to adopt Climate Smart Agriculture practices. A just energy transition for SADC should recognise the potential role of energy access in ensuring the achievement of the triple objectives of increasing productivity, adaptation, and mitigation in the agriculture sector.
Agsint tis background, Oxfam in Southern Africa Cluster and Oxfam South Africa in collaboration with the SADC Parliamentary Forum (SADC PF) and partner organisations, namely Access Coalition, Climate Action Network-South Africa and Institute for Economic Justice convened a learning event targeting the SADC PF Standing Committee on Food Agriculture and Natural Resources (FANR) on 27th-28th September 2023 in Namibia.
